ROCHESTER, N.Y. (September 16, 2011)
-  The Men's and Women's Soccer teams both earned much needed wins tonight. The Men's side won 6-0 on the road at Fisher College in Boston, Mass. The Women's team won 3-0 at home versus Carlow University.

The star of the night for the Women's game was senior Erika Ludke (Greece, N.Y.). The reigning American Mideast Conference player of the year eanred the hat-trick, scoring in the 16th, 29th, and 86th minutes to seal the win. The Raiders improve to 4-3-0 and 1-0-0 in conference play.

In Boston, the Men's team cruised to a 6-0 win over an outmatched Fisher College side. Senior Dominic Coco (Spencerport, N.Y.) added to his tally with two goals in the match. Freshman forward Caleb Orbaker (Holley, N.Y.) got in on the action with a brace of his own. Donovan Wilson and Ricky DiPasquale also added goals for the Raiders. The team improves to 3-3-0 with the win.

The Women's team will travel to Pittsburgh on Wednesday for a re-match agianst Carlow University with a 4pm start. The Men's team faces Fisher College again tomorrow at 2pm in Boston, Mass.
